Calibrating of interactive touch system for image compositing

1. A method of calibrating a touch system comprising a matte/chroma-key blue-screen composite imaging processing system and touch input device having an active touch area which comprises:

  • positioning the touch input device on a matte/chroma-key backdrop such that the active touch area of the touch input device is in a known location with reference to an imaging camera and composite image field of view,illuminating a fiducial perimeter of the active touch area by a synchronized pulsed light emission of four laser sources for a time duration of less than one frame exposure time long to obtain laser flash fiducial images,selecting one image frame containing a laser flash fiducial image of the touch system active touch area fiducial perimeter,subjecting the laser flash fiducial image to recognition software analysis to derive a position of the illuminated fiducial perimeter of the active touch area,retrieving appropriate calibration template files from memory, andcomparing the calibration template files to a size and position of the active touch area laser flash fiducial imageselecting and loading the calibration template file that matches the laser flash fiducial image, andcompleting the calibration.
